Durham, N.C. — Durham's mayor is the latest local leader to get vaccinated against the coronavirus.
Fransine "Frankie" Sanchez, a nurse, gave Mayor Steve Schewel the vaccine on Friday morning.
"It was an incredible feeling of happiness to get the vaccine, and I encourage all to sign up," Schewel said on Twitter.
Schewel received the Moderna vaccine.
